Liverpool Lime Street Station has been awarded the prestigious title “Station of the Year” at the National Rail Awards 2010.

The National Rail Awards celebrate excellence and achievement in the railway industry and in selecting Lime Street as the "Overall Station of the Year" and "Large Station of the Year".

The judges felt that “The front of the station, with its magnificent arch, now fully restored, presents a splendid spectacle from the approach and is one of the best in the country.”

Merseytravel has recently completed a £2.6m refurbishment scheme to the interior of the station, working with partners Virgin, Northern Rail and Network Rail, updating and enhancing the city’s famous station.

Councillor Mark Dowd, Merseytravel chairman, said: “The upgrade to the station has been a massive success, and was not before time; some of the station had remained untouched since before Beatlemania."
